The picture shows a view of this Colorful Old Unused Downtown St. Petersburg Florida Post Card. This postcard is not dated but it is believed to be from the 1920s. It has a divided back and the postage area is marked ''PLACE ONE CENT STAMP HERE - FIVE CENTS TO ANYWHERE IN U.S. VIA AIRMAIL''.

The card pictures many people on green benches with early automobiles behind them. There are buildings and some have old advertising signs. A few of the old signs can be read such as ''RUTLAND BROTHERS'', ''PHILPITT'S VICTROLAS PIANOS'', ''POWER'', ''RESTAURANT'', and more. It is marked on the front and back as follows:

''OH, YOU GREEN BENCHERS,'' ST. PETERSBURG, FLORIDA ''THE SUNSHINE CITY''
Started a scant 25 years ago, St. Petersburg's Green Benches, which line the sidewalks of the street, now have international fame. There are 5000 benches on the streets with a seating capacity of 25,000, and, on any sunshiney winter afternoon, one may find them filled with winter visitors enjoying spring like weather.
MADE IN U.S.A. BY E. C. KROPP CO., MILWAUKEE

The postcard measures about 5-9/16'' x 3-9/16''. It appears to be in excellent unused condition with some age spotting on the edge as pictured.
